A study led by Isha Jain at Gladstone Institutes found that red blood cells (RBCs) play a crucial role in lowering glucose levels in hypoxic conditions, as they upregulate GLUT1 transporters and metabolize more glucose to produce 2,3-DPG, which aids oxygen release. This discovery highlights the potential for new diabetes therapies targeting RBC metabolism or turnover.
